Apple TV
Apple TV FeaturesConnectionApple TV connects to a TV or possibly any other audio/video device through HDMI or component video connection. Apple TV supports standard definition TVs as well as enhanced-definition and high-definition widescreen TVs. Picture may be stretched vertically if TV does not support anamorphic widescreen. SyncingApple TV connects to Mac or PC wirelessly through the standard IEEE 802.11b, 802.11g, 802.11n protocols as well as through standart Ethernet connection. Apple TV syncs with computer just like iPod. It syncs with iTunes library, copying content to or from build-in 40GB hard drive. User can specify whether to sync all iTunes content in a specified order, or just selected content. Device can also be used to stream content from iTunes libraries to up to five computers joined in a network. InterfaceApple TV has a user-friendly menu interface with seven options: Movies, TV Shows, Music, Podcasts, Photos, Settings, and Sources. The Movie, TV Shows, Music and Podcasts options are used to play synced or stored content. Apple TV can connect directly to the iTunes store and play its previews. Both video and audio-only podcasts are supported. Photos menu allows to view photos that have been synced to the device, it does not stream photos from other computers, although Apple promised to add this feature in the future. Settings allows to pair the device with a remote control. Apple Remote is shipped with Apple TV. Other remotes should work just fine too. From this menu you can also update the system software, configure video and audio settings. Sources option is for connecting Apple TV with computers for syncing or streaming. Users are required to enter iTunes code for authorization. File FormatsApple TV supports limited number of formats. It should be either H.264 video codec with max resolution of 720p @ 24 fps or MPEG-4 with max resolution of 720×432 (432p) @ 30 fps. Apple TV supports MP3, AAC, AIFF, Apple Lossless and WAV audio codecs. FairPlay DRM protected files are also supported. For photos JPEG, BMP, GIF, TIFF, and PNG should be used.
